Why TypeScript is a Must-Have for Scalable JavaScript Applications
Introduction: The JavaScript Evolution
If you’ve been working with JavaScript for a while, you know how messy things can get. Uncaught errors, type mismatches, and debugging nightmares—sound familiar?
That’s exactly why TypeScript has become a game-changer for developers and businesses looking to build scalable JavaScript applications.
Whether you're managing a large-scale web app, a high-traffic SaaS platform, or a growing startup, switching to TypeScript can save you time, reduce bugs, and improve team productivity.
In this blog, we’ll dive into:
✅ Why TypeScript is the best choice for scalable JavaScript applications
✅ How it enhances performance, maintainability, and collaboration
✅ Why companies like Airbnb, Slack, and Microsoft rely on it
✅ How you can hire the best TypeScript developers for your next project
Let’s get started! 🚀
Why TypeScript? The Key Advantages Over JavaScript
1. TypeScript Makes Large-Scale Applications More Maintainable
Ever worked on a JavaScript codebase with hundreds of files and thousands of lines of code? If so, you know how frustrating it can be to debug issues caused by unexpected data types or missing variables.
TypeScript solves this by adding static typing, making your codebase:
- Easier to understand (developers instantly know what each variable is supposed to be)
- Less prone to errors (no more
undefined is not a function
surprises) - More predictable (type safety ensures fewer runtime crashes)
Example:
With TypeScript, if someone tries to pass a string instead of a number, they’ll get a compile-time error, rather than discovering the issue after deployment.
🔍 Real-World Impact:
Companies like Slack migrated their JavaScript codebase to TypeScript to improve maintainability, reduce bugs, and enhance performance.
2. Boosting Developer Productivity with Better Tooling
One of the biggest advantages of TypeScript is improved developer experience.
✅ Code autocompletion & IntelliSense – Your IDE (like VS Code) provides smart suggestions, reducing typos and syntax errors.
✅ Refactoring is easier – Changing function signatures or renaming variables is safer and quicker.
✅ Fewer runtime errors – You catch bugs before they even reach production.
💡 Did You Know?
Developers using TypeScript spend 30% less time debugging compared to JavaScript, according to a study by GitHub.
3. TypeScript Is Ideal for Scalable Applications
For growing applications, scalability isn’t just about handling more users—it’s about ensuring code remains clean, organized, and maintainable as the team expands.
TypeScript enables:
- Modular architecture for large teams
- Code consistency across different contributors
- Easier onboarding of new developers
🔍 Example: Airbnb adopted TypeScript to help their engineering team manage a complex codebase while growing rapidly.
TypeScript vs. JavaScript: Why TS Wins for Scalability
It’s clear: TypeScript is the superior choice for serious software projects.
How TypeScript Powers Modern JavaScript Frameworks
If you’re working with React, Angular, or Node.js, TypeScript provides huge benefits.
1. TypeScript + React: The Perfect Combination
React developers are increasingly switching to TypeScript for:
✅ Stronger component typing
✅ Better state management
✅ Fewer runtime issues
📌 Fact: Over 60% of React developers use TypeScript for production applications.
2. Angular Is Built with TypeScript
Unlike React, Angular is a TypeScript-first framework. That means better tooling, cleaner architecture, and more maintainable enterprise apps.
3. Node.js + TypeScript: A Match for Scalable Backends
✅ Improved API security
✅ Predictable data handling
✅ Better microservices support
🔍 Example: Microsoft uses TypeScript heavily in Node.js applications to ensure performance and maintainability.
The Business Case for TypeScript: Why Companies Are Making the Switch
🚀 Case Study 1: Slack
Slack transitioned from JavaScript to TypeScript and reduced critical runtime errors by 50%.
🚀 Case Study 2: Airbnb
Airbnb’s engineering team moved to TypeScript to improve code consistency and reduce debugging time.
🚀 Case Study 3: Microsoft
TypeScript was created by Microsoft and is now used internally in all large-scale software projects.
How TypeScript Saves Businesses Money
💰 Fewer production bugs → Less downtime → Higher customer satisfaction
💰 More productive developers → Faster feature releases → Competitive advantage
💰 Easier hiring & onboarding → Reduced developer churn → Lower recruitment costs
Where to Find the Best TypeScript Developers
If you’re building a scalable web application, you need skilled TypeScript developers. But where do you find them?
Top Hiring Platforms
1️⃣ Remoteplatz – 🌍 The best place to hire top remote TypeScript developers for scalable projects.
2️⃣ Toptal – High-quality freelancers (but expensive).
3️⃣ Upwork – A mix of talent, but requires time to vet candidates.
4️⃣ Stack Overflow Jobs – Good for finding senior engineers.
5️⃣ Arc.dev – Remote developer hiring, but with limited TypeScript specialists.
Why Choose Remoteplatz?
✅ Pre-vetted TypeScript developers
✅ Expertise in React, Angular, and Node.js
✅ Flexible hiring models: Full-time, part-time, or project-based
✅ Fast matching to the right developer for your needs
🚀 Looking for TypeScript experts? Hire the best remote developers at Remoteplatz today!
Final Thoughts: Is TypeScript Worth It?
If you're serious about building scalable JavaScript applications, switching to TypeScript is a no-brainer.
✅ Fewer bugs, better performance
✅ Easier collaboration across teams
✅ Stronger typing for more reliable code
✅ Perfect for React, Angular, and Node.js
✅ A growing ecosystem with long-term support
And if you need the best TypeScript developers to build your project, Remoteplatz is your best bet!
🚀 Ready to scale your application? Hire TypeScript developers today!